well how about I bring back an old thread. I've gotten into a crazy addicting game that is :eek: all about killing the entire world! Now it sounds a bit freaky, but is crazy addicting. You "infect" a person from a country with a disease type, then your goal is to infect the entire world, and kill them all while not having a cure found and losing by being cured.

This is an app that has actually been shown to the CDC and simulates a real world example of the spread of a plague so it's actually kind of interesting. So the game is called "Plague Inc." it can be found here: Plague Inc. and from there you can click the iphone or the android links and be directed to your respective mobile platform.

I'm currently playing on the fungus, on normal difficult and have successfully infected the entire world, without being caught, and can tell you that in the game there are 6,811,136,495 people in the game world. Anyone that gets into it let me know it's fun game and it's free, but can cost money if you so choose.
